template<int StorageOrder> \
struct partial_lu_impl<EIGTYPE, StorageOrder,
lapack_int> \
{ \
\
{ \
EIGEN_UNUSED_VARIABLE(maxBlockSize);\
\
lda = convert_index<lapack_int>(luStride); \
ipiv = row_transpositions; \
m = convert_index<lapack_int>(
rows); \
n = convert_index<lapack_int>(
cols); \
\
info = LAPACKE_##LAPACKE_PREFIX##getrf( matrix_order,
m,
n, (LAPACKE_TYPE*)
a,
lda, ipiv ); \
\
\
eigen_assert(
info >= 0); \
\
\
first_zero_pivot =
info; \
return first_zero_pivot; \
} \
};
Matrix3f m
Definition AngleAxis_mimic_euler.cpp:1
ArrayXXi a
Definition Array_initializer_list_23_cxx11.cpp:1
int n
Definition BiCGSTAB_simple.cpp:1
int i
Definition BiCGSTAB_step_by_step.cpp:9
int rows
Definition Tutorial_commainit_02.cpp:1
int cols
Definition Tutorial_commainit_02.cpp:1
* lda
Definition eigenvalues.cpp:59
else if n * info
Definition cholesky.cpp:18
int nb_transpositions
Definition lu.cpp:30
#define LAPACK_COL_MAJOR
Definition lapacke.h:123
#define lapack_int
Definition lapacke.h:49
#define LAPACK_ROW_MAJOR
Definition lapacke.h:122